Sir Sean Connery tops favourite Scots actor poll

SIR Sean Connery has been voted Scotland’s favourite actor in a cinema poll.

The James Bond star took a quarter of all votes in the Odeon survey of more than 1,000 Scottish residents.

Former Dr Who actor David Tennant came second with 17 per cent of votes and in third place with 12 per cent was Ewan McGregor.

Gerard Butler and Robbie Coltrane completed the top five, with James McAvoy, Peter Capaldi and Alan Cumming also receiving fans’ votes.

Odeon asked people in Scotland to name their favourite star to mark the opening on Friday of a new cinema at Fort Kinnaird in Edinburgh.

FlyResearch surveyed 1,048 Scottish residents on March 11 and 12.
